Serve in a Collins glass
12 fresh | Mint leaves |
2 oz | Bison grass vodka |
1 oz | Camomile tea (cold) |
3 1⁄2 oz | Apple juice/apple cider (cloudy & unsweetened) |
1⁄4 oz | Lime juice (freshly squeezed) |
1⁄4 oz | Monin Pure Cane Syrup (65.0°brix, equivalent to 2:1 rich syrup) |
Garnish: Lime wedge & mint sprig
Lightly MUDDLE mint in base of shaker (just to bruise). SHAKE all ingredients with ice and fine strain into ice-filled glass.
Refreshing and floral with a dry, citrus finish.
Created in 2002 by Domhnall Carlin at Apartment, Belfast, Northern Ireland.
